Stagefright again

I installed the latest Stagefright Detector app on my Fire Phone and Fire HD6. Apparently some additional vulnerabilities have been found and the update we got some weeks ago did not patch them all. Got the same results for both, as one might expect:

I did that last time (my one and only Mayday call to date), talked to four different people, none of whom knew anything about it. About a week later, an update dropped that fixed the then-known issues. So I think we can assume they pay attention to this stuff. Zimperium seems pretty ethical and probably contacts the affected vendors before publishing their findings publicly so they have had a chance to prepare patches. If I remember it was announced at Black Hat conference, and the patch probably arrived less than 3 weeks later.

The HD6 is getting the 5.x update, which may well have all these fixes in it, but it will be interesting to see if they come through with an update for Fire Phone. At least in its original manifestation phones were more vulnerable as texting provided the easiest exploit.

Meanwhile my Moto G remains unpatched, months after it was reported. The wireless company has stated an update is coming but that was awhile ago. The complication there is that they take Motorola's update and then have to add their customization.
